Guest: Mark Cobbold — Vice President of Product Management, Ribbon

Mark Cobbold, Vice President of Product Management at Ribbon, draws on a career spanning Bell Northern Research, Nortel and Genband to explain how voice networks are moving from physical and virtualised deployments to genuinely cloud-native architectures. The conversation covers microservices and Kubernetes, public versus private cloud choices for carriers and enterprises, security patching cadence, observability, and the shift from capex to opex.

Key insights

  • Cloud-native does not mean public cloud only — carriers and enterprises run the same containerised functions in private data centres, public cloud or hybrid, with the decision driven by expansion speed and data residency regulation rather than technology. ▶ 5:38
  • Products are built so workloads can be repatriated: a core network can sit in a private cloud in the home country while satellite countries spin up in public cloud, then consolidate later. ▶ 7:11
  • The CI/CD, test automation and orchestration tooling comes straight from the IT domain, so IT skill sets are now directly portable onto telecom networks — a common toolchain spans private and public cloud deployments. ▶ 7:41
  • NIST publishes around 30,000 vulnerabilities a year across the industry; underlying components such as Red Hat Linux need continuous patching, so the old 'get it working then patch once a year' model creates a technical deficit that becomes very hard to dig out of. ▶ 9:12
  • Migration testing uses digital twinning to map lab configuration to production, extracting real production call flows and applying machine learning to reduce them to a unique set of test cases for full coverage. ▶ 13:17
  • Observability runs on two tracks: a Prometheus backbone collecting fault data from the microservices architecture, and the Ribbon Analytics data lake combining CDRs, call flows and fault reports — with a 'Most Probable Cause' application correlating them to point at the offending network element. ▶ 14:18
  • Customers on cloud-native report rolling a new feature across an entire network in three months and a software fix in a week; critical security fixes go out in days, and graveyard-shift maintenance windows disappear. ▶ 16:53
  • Commercially it moves capex to an annualised opex model comparable to Microsoft 365 licensing, freeing capital for revenue-generating projects rather than the telecoms network itself. ▶ 15:21
  • Kubernetes finally delivers the scale-in/scale-out and lifecycle management that VNF orchestrators never achieved — early virtualisation was effectively one-to-one with hardware. ▶ 21:28
  • Ribbon Connect Plus is being built as an SBC-as-a-service offering in public or private cloud so customers do not need to build their own cloud infrastructure; the existing Call Trust service already runs cloud-native on AWS with its own CI/CD pipeline. ▶ 23:01
